As a Driver Valetor at JCT600, you will ensure every vehicle looks its best and arrives exactly where it needs to be.

Day-to-day responsibilities include:

  • Preparing vehicles to a high standard for showroom display, delivery, or collection.
  • Carrying out interior and exterior valeting, including washing, vacuuming, and finishing.
  • Assisting with vehicle movements on-site and between departments as required.
  • Maintaining cleanliness of the valet bay and work areas, following health and safety guidelines.
